Abstract

The purpose of this study was to contextualise players’ high-intensity activities (HIA) with individual tactical actions during match play with reference to playing positions. Tracking data was obtained using local positioning system devices from 19 male elite futsal players (28.8 ± 2.4 years). The HIA measures included high-intensity acceleration (ACC; ≥3 m · s−2), deceleration (DEC; ≤−3 m · s−2), and high-speed running (HSR; ≥18 km · h−1). Tracking data and match footage were synchronised using the SPRO™ to code players’ physical performance and technical-tactical actions.
